Basic info on Mercedes Benz E 240

The German car was first shown in year 2002 and powered by a 6 - cylinder nat. asp. petrol unit, produced by Mercedes Benz. The engine offers a displacement of 2.6 litre matched to a rear wheel drive system and a manual gearbox with 6 or a automatic gearbox with 5 gears. Vehicle in question is a luxury car with the top speed of 236km/h, reaching the 100km/h (62mph) mark in 9.1s and consuming around 10.9 liters of fuel every 100 kilometers.
